Pop Culture Round-Up: Starbucks, SNL and Star Wars

The Victoria’s Secret Fashion Show took place this week. The show featured newcomers Gigi Hadid and Kendall Jenner, because why have a bunch of nobody supermodels when you can have a member of the Kardashian clan and her best friend?

People are freaking out over Starbucks’ red cups. The red cups feature a more minimalistic design this year, noticeably lacking the signature snowflakes and elves usually featured on the cup. While some like the cleaner design, others are claiming that Starbucks hates Christmas.

The first trailer for “Finding Dory” has premiered. The movie is a sequel to the classic “Finding Nemo.” There’s not much to say about it, other than it’s a sequel to a beloved Pixar movie, so just go ahead and watch the trailer.

Speaking of Disney sequels, yet another Star Wars trailer has been released. The trailer features a longer look at some of the characters and teases possible relationships between them. Noticeably absent from this trailer and all promotional materials is Luke Skywalker, except for a glimpse of his prosthetic hand. This is no accident. Director J.J. Abrams has stated there is a very deliberate reason he won’t appear in any trailers or pictures.

Donald Trump hosted Saturday Night Live last Saturday, much to the dismay of everyone petitioning for SNL to drop him as a host. However, what those people don’t realize is they’re part of the reason he was asked to host in the first place. Controversy leads to views, and Trump is one of the most controversial people around. Coincidentally, the episode he hosted gave SNL the highest number of viewers it has had since 2012.
